Handling the dicey task of parenting was the focus of a parenting seminar at MIMS Educational Resources Limited, Lagos.
The seminar with the theme: “Parental Roles in Child Psychology and Development” was attended by key education stakeholders in November.
A seasoned counsellor, Mrs Fatimah Jaji, diagnosed the topic: ‘The home, Economic and Environmental effect of Child Psychology and development in the 21st century’.
In his speech, MIMS board chairman, Adesegun Ogungbayi, stressed the need to ensure proper monitoring and mentorship of young ones towards academic excellence devoid of immorality at all times.
